摘要
将钢筋利用真空镀膜沉积在光纤的纤芯上 ,使之形成敏感光纤 ,从而制备了用于监测模拟混凝土结构钢筋腐蚀的光纤传感器 ,该方法基于光纤纤芯上的敏感膜能够将腐蚀信息传递给光纤内传导的光波 ,从而获取腐蚀信息 ,实现腐蚀监测。对光纤传感器上钢筋膜的腐蚀传感能力的研究 。
An optical fibre sensor for sensing the corrosion degree on reinforcement in concrete construction consists of 3 parts: a photoemitting circuit, a photoreceiver circuit and a sensitive optical fiber which is made after its core has been plated with reinforced steel bar membrane.On the core of the optical fibre, the vacuum plated sensitive film can transmit the corrosion information to the light wave which is transporting inside the fibre. In this way, corrosion information can be detected. Researches into the sensibility to corrosion of the reinforced steel film which is on the core of the optical fibre have proved that it is feasible to apply optical fibre sensor technology to monitor the reinforcement corrosion in concrete construction.
